[RESEND PATCH v9 10/13] IIO: ADC: add stm32 DFSDM support for PDM microphone

Arnaud Pouliquen arnaud.pouliquen at st.com
Wed Jan 10 02:13:12 PST 2018


This code offers a way to handle PDM audio microphones in
ASOC framework. Audio driver should use consumer API.
A specific management is implemented for DMA, with a
callback, to allows to handle audio buffers efficiently.

diff --git a/Documentation/ABI/testing/sysfs-bus-iio-dfsdm-adc-stm32 b/Documentation/ABI/testing/sysfs-bus-iio-dfsdm-adc-stm32
new file mode 100644
index 0000000..da98223
--- /dev/null
+++ b/Documentation/ABI/testing/sysfs-bus-iio-dfsdm-adc-stm32
@@ -0,0 +1,16 @@
+What:		/sys/bus/iio/devices/iio:deviceX/in_voltage_spi_clk_freq
+KernelVersion:	4.14
+Contact:	arnaud.pouliquen at st.com
+Description:
+		For audio purpose only.
+		Used by audio driver to set/get the spi input frequency.
+		This is mandatory if DFSDM is slave on SPI bus, to
+		provide information on the SPI clock frequency during runtime
+		Notice that the SPI frequency should be a multiple of sample
+		frequency to ensure the precision.
+		if DFSDM input is SPI master
+			Reading  SPI clkout frequency,
+			error on writing
+		If DFSDM input is SPI Slave:
+			Reading returns value previously set.
+			Writing value before starting conversions.

+static int stm32_dfsdm_set_watermark(struct iio_dev *indio_dev,
+				     unsigned int val)
+{
+	struct stm32_dfsdm_adc *adc = iio_priv(indio_dev);
+	unsigned int watermark = DFSDM_DMA_BUFFER_SIZE / 2;
+
+	/*
+	 * DMA cyclic transfers are used, buffer is split into two periods.
+	 * There should be :
+	 * - always one buffer (period) DMA is working on
+	 * - one buffer (period) driver pushed to ASoC side.
+	 */
+	watermark = min(watermark, val * (unsigned int)(sizeof(u32)));
+	adc->buf_sz = watermark * 2;
+
+	return 0;
+}
+
+static unsigned int stm32_dfsdm_adc_dma_residue(struct stm32_dfsdm_adc *adc)
+{
+	struct dma_tx_state state;
+	enum dma_status status;
+
+	status = dmaengine_tx_status(adc->dma_chan,
+				     adc->dma_chan->cookie,
+				     &state);
+	if (status == DMA_IN_PROGRESS) {
+		/* Residue is size in bytes from end of buffer */
+		unsigned int i = adc->buf_sz - state.residue;
+		unsigned int size;
+
+		/* Return available bytes */
+		if (i >= adc->bufi)
+			size = i - adc->bufi;
+		else
+			size = adc->buf_sz + i - adc->bufi;
+
+		return size;
+	}
+
+	return 0;
+}
+
+static void stm32_dfsdm_audio_dma_buffer_done(void *data)
+{
+	struct iio_dev *indio_dev = data;
+	struct stm32_dfsdm_adc *adc = iio_priv(indio_dev);
+	int available = stm32_dfsdm_adc_dma_residue(adc);
+	size_t old_pos;
+
+	/*
+	 * FIXME: In Kernel interface does not support cyclic DMA buffer,and
+	 * offers only an interface to push data samples per samples.
+	 * For this reason IIO buffer interface is not used and interface is
+	 * bypassed using a private callback registered by ASoC.
+	 * This should be a temporary solution waiting a cyclic DMA engine
+	 * support in IIO.
+	 */
+
+	dev_dbg(&indio_dev->dev, "%s: pos = %d, available = %d\n", __func__,
+		adc->bufi, available);
+	old_pos = adc->bufi;
+
+	while (available >= indio_dev->scan_bytes) {
+		u32 *buffer = (u32 *)&adc->rx_buf[adc->bufi];
+
+		/* Mask 8 LSB that contains the channel ID */
+		*buffer = (*buffer & 0xFFFFFF00) << 8;
+		available -= indio_dev->scan_bytes;
+		adc->bufi += indio_dev->scan_bytes;
+		if (adc->bufi >= adc->buf_sz) {
+			if (adc->cb)
+				adc->cb(&adc->rx_buf[old_pos],
+					 adc->buf_sz - old_pos, adc->cb_priv);
+			adc->bufi = 0;
+			old_pos = 0;
+		}
+	}
+	if (adc->cb)
+		adc->cb(&adc->rx_buf[old_pos], adc->bufi - old_pos,
+			adc->cb_priv);
+}
